引言

随着区块链技术的进步,越来越多的人开始使用加密货币进行交易。EOS作为一种新兴的区块链平台,其钱包转账功能受到了广泛关注。然而,在进行EOS转账时,用户可能会遇到“计算资源不足”的提示。这个问题不仅困扰着新手用户,也让一些老用户感到困惑。本文将全面解析该问题的原因、解决方案以及相关的常见问答。

什么是EOS计算资源?

EOS区块链使用三种主要资源来管理和处理交易:CPU、NET和RAM。这三种资源是为了能够支持智能合约和去中心化应用的正常运作。每个EOS账户都必须拥有足够的这些资源才能发送交易和执行智能合约。

具体而言,CPU资源用于计算和执行智能合约;NET资源用于传输数据;而RAM是存储状态数据的空间。在EOS生态系统中,用户需要质押一定数量的EOS代币,才能获得这些计算资源。

为什么会提示计算资源不足?

当你在EOS钱包中进行转账时,如果遇到“计算资源不足”的提示,通常说明你的账户没有足够的CPU或NET资源来处理该笔交易。这种情况可能由以下几种原因导致:

  1. 账户未质押足够的EOS:为了获得所需的计算资源,用户需要质押一定数量的EOS代币。如果未质押足够的EOS,交易可能会失败。
  2. 网络繁忙:在网络高峰期,所有用户的计算资源需求增大,可能导致应用或钱包无法满足特定交易的资源需求。
  3. 合约复杂性:一些复杂的智能合约执行需要更多的CPU和NET资源。如果你的转账涉及复杂的合约逻辑,可能会消耗更高的计算资源。
  4. 计算资源配置不足:有时候,即使用户质押了EOS,系统分配给他们的计算资源也可能不足。

如何解决计算资源不足的问题?

如果你在EOS钱包转账时遇到计算资源不足的提示,可以考虑以下几种解决方案:

1. 增加CPU和NET的质押

用户可以通过质押更多的EOS代币来增加其CPU和NET资源。这是一种直接且有效的解决办法。质押的过程相对简单,用户只需在EOS钱包中选择相应的功能,将EOS代币质押给其账户即可。

在质押时,用户需要注意不同平台的规定。有些平台可能会对质押和解质押的时间有严格限制,因此,在进行质押操作前,最好提前查看相关规则。

2. 切换到其他钱包或平台

某些EOS钱包或平台在资源管理和分配方面可能更为高效。如果经常在某个钱包中遇到计算资源不足的问题,用户可以尝试切换到其他钱包。这些钱包可能有更好的资源策略,能够在网络繁忙时仍然满足用户的需求。

3. 查看网络状态

用户可以通过EOS区块链浏览器查看当前网络状态,特别是在进行重要交易之前。了解网络繁忙程度,可以帮助用户选择一个更合适的时间进行转账。此时,可以选择在交易量较低的时段进行转账操作,也许可以避免资源不足的问题。

4. 简化交易内容

在一些情况下,转账的内容或涉及的智能合约过于复杂,导致计算资源需求过高。用户可以考虑交易流程,尽量简化涉及的合约逻辑。这可以帮助减轻在转账时对计算资源的需求,使转账更为顺畅。

5. 监控和更新资源使用情况

定期监控自己账户的CPU和NET资源使用情况,可以帮助用户及时发现潜在的问题。若资源使用与实际需求不符,用户可以选择重新质押或注销部分资源。此外,及时更新钱包和平台至最新版本,也能帮助提高资源管理的有效性。

常见问题解析

1.EOS钱包转账时,计算资源不足的频率高吗?

在EOS网络中,由于市场环境及交易热度的变化,计算资源不足的频率也会有波动。通常来说,在网络拥堵时,用户会频繁遇到这个问题。在当前竞争激烈的市场情况下,随着更多用户加入EOS生态,网络资源的需求不断增加,导致部分用户在转账时面临资源不足的情况。

另外,EOS钱包、应用和生态中涉及的合约逻辑的复杂性也是影响计算资源使用的因素之一。当合约复杂时,CPU和NET的需求大幅增加,再加上节点分配资源的策略不同,导致资源不足的问题频繁出现。

为减少这种烦恼,用户在使用EOS进行转账时,可以尽量选择网络相对较空闲的时段,并将转账金额与操作的复杂度进行合理调配,以降低资源不足的可能性。

2.转账时如何判断自己需要多少计算资源?

判断自己需要的计算资源并没有固定的公式,这与多个因素有关,例如转账的复杂程度、网络状况,以及目标账户的资源情况等。

用户可以通过几种方式粗略估算自己需要的资源:

  1. 参考历史交易:可以查看自己之前的转账记录,获取所需的CPU和NET使用情况。如果之前的交易顺利完成,则说明这些资源的分配足够。
  2. 使用资源估算工具:许多EOS钱包和区块链浏览器提供资源估算工具,可以帮助用户预估某个交易所需的资源。
  3. 检查网络状况:在网络高峰期,通常需要更多的资源。因此,查看当前网络的负载情况,有助于用户更好地判断自己所需的计算资源。

3.如何我的EOS钱包以防止计算资源不足?

要你的EOS钱包,防止计算资源不足的问题,可以采取以下几种措施:

  1. 定期监测资源使用情况:保持对CPU、NET和RAM使用情况的监测,及时查看和调整资源配置。
  2. 选择合适的交易时间:避免在网络拥堵时段进行转账,选择在网络负载相对较低的时段进行交易,可以减少资源不足的发生几率。
  3. 进行资源设置:部分EOS钱包提供了设置的选项,用户可以根据个人使用状态进行精准设置,以达到最佳性能。
  4. 注重合约的简单性:尽可能简化转账或智能合约的内容,以降低对CPU和NET资源的需求。

4.EOS的计算资源是如何计算的?

EOS的计算资源是通过质押EOS代币来获得的,具体如下:

  1. 质押EOS代币:用户需要将一定数量的EOS代币进行质押,相应数量的CPU和NET资源将被分配给该账户。
  2. 动态资源分配:EOS系统会根据市场供需情况动态调整资源的分配算法,提升资源分配的公正性和合理性。
  3. 资源消耗监测:用户在进行交易时,系统会实时监测其资源消耗情况,确保交易顺利进行。

5.如果我继续遇到计算资源不足的问题,该如何投诉或反馈?

如果在使用EOS钱包转账时,为了有效地反馈“计算资源不足”的问题,可以采取以下几种方式:

  1. 联系钱包客服:如果遇到持续的资源不足问题,可以直接联系所用钱包平台的客服。例如,在官网或应用内寻找客户支持功能,与客服沟通并提供详细信息。
  2. 参与社区讨论:很多EOS项目都有自己的社区和论坛,用户可以在这里寻求帮助,分享彼此的经验,并找到可能的解决方法。
  3. 发起提案与投票:在EOS类似的治理框架下,用户可以通过提案的方式向系统反馈问题,并通过投票进行支持。

结论

EOS钱包转账时提示计算资源不足的问题,常常是由多个因素导致的,而通过有效的质押资源管理和相应的手段,可以有效减少这类问题的发生。在不断发展的区块链技术背景下,用户与钱包平台之间的互动是确保良好运作的基础。希望通过本文的详细解读,用户能够更好地理解EOS钱包及其计算资源管理,顺利完成每一次转账。